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 4 of 4 for SuiteID (0.07 sec)

  1. src/crypto/internal/hpke/hpke.go

    	return ciphertext, nil
    }
    
    func SuiteID(kemID, kdfID, aeadID uint16) []byte {
    	suiteID := make([]byte, 0, 4+2+2+2)
    	suiteID = append(suiteID, []byte("HPKE")...)
    	suiteID = binary.BigEndian.AppendUint16(suiteID, kemID)
    	suiteID = binary.BigEndian.AppendUint16(suiteID, kdfID)
    	suiteID = binary.BigEndian.AppendUint16(suiteID, aeadID)
    	return suiteID
    }
    
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ed May 22 22:33:33 UTC 2024
    - 7K bytes
    - Viewed (0)
  2. src/crypto/tls/handshake_client.go

    		preferenceOrder = cipherSuitesPreferenceOrderNoAES
    	}
    	configCipherSuites := config.cipherSuites()
    	hello.cipherSuites = make([]uint16, 0, len(configCipherSuites))
    
    	for _, suiteId := range preferenceOrder {
    		suite := mutualCipherSuite(configCipherSuites, suiteId)
    		if suite == nil {
    			continue
    		}
    		// Don't advertise TLS 1.2-only cipher suites unless
    		// we're attempting TLS 1.2.
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Thu May 23 03:10:12 UTC 2024
    - 38.6K bytes
    - Viewed (0)
  3. src/crypto/tls/handshake_server.go

    	}
    
    	configCipherSuites := c.config.cipherSuites()
    	preferenceList := make([]uint16, 0, len(configCipherSuites))
    	for _, suiteID := range preferenceOrder {
    		for _, id := range configCipherSuites {
    			if id == suiteID {
    				preferenceList = append(preferenceList, id)
    				break
    			}
    		}
    	}
    
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ed May 22 21:30:50 UTC 2024
    - 27.6K bytes
    - Viewed (0)
  4. src/crypto/tls/handshake_server_tls13.go

    	if !hasAESGCMHardwareSupport || !aesgcmPreferred(hs.clientHello.cipherSuites) {
    		preferenceList = defaultCipherSuitesTLS13NoAES
    	}
    	for _, suiteID := range preferenceList {
    		hs.suite = mutualCipherSuiteTLS13(hs.clientHello.cipherSuites, suiteID)
    		if hs.suite != nil {
    			break
    		}
    	}
    	if hs.suite == nil {
    		c.sendAlert(alertHandshakeFailure)
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ed May 22 17:23:54 UTC 2024
    - 30.5K bytes
    - Viewed (0)
Back to top